🏥 Facility Summary

FOOTHILL ACRES REHABILITATION & NURSING CENTER is a 3-star nursing home in HILLSBOROUGH, NJ with 200 beds.

What is the quality rating of FOOTHILL ACRES REHABILITATION & NURSING CENTER?
FOOTHILL ACRES REHABILITATION & NURSING CENTER has a 3-star rating out of 5 from CMS. This is an average rating, meeting basic quality standards. The rating is based on health inspections, staffing levels, and quality measures.
